Abstract

The utility model discloses a lithium ion battery cell module, which comprises a protective aluminum film, a battery cell, a positive electrode lug, a negative electrode lug, a sealing plate, a rubber plug, a positioning bolt, a protective shell and a protective plate, wherein the protective aluminum film is wound and hermetically encapsulated outside the battery cell, the positive electrode lug and the negative electrode lug are arranged on one side of the battery cell, the battery cell is sheathed at the inner diameter of the protective shell and is positioned and installed by using the sealing plate and the rubber plug, the positioning bolt clamps and positions the battery cell and the protective shell, the protective plate is arranged outside the protective shell for impact protection, the lithium ion battery cell module is characterized in that the protective shell is provided with a triangular buffer plate which is uniformly distributed on the basis of a bottom base plate body, the triangular buffer plate is composed of a plurality of groups of triangular plate bodies, the structural strength is high, the impact resistance is good, the external impact can be effectively buffered, the damage of the impact to the battery cell is reduced, a supporting rubber pad is used as a structural support for fixing the position of the battery cell, and the sliding of the battery cell in the inner diameter of the protective shell is avoided, the guard plate is aluminum alloy honeycomb panel material, and matter is light structural strength is high.

Detailed Description
The invention is explained in further detail below with reference to the figures and the embodiments.
As shown in fig. 1, fig. 2, fig. 3 and fig. 4, a lithium ion battery cell module, including protective aluminum film 1, electric core 2, positive electrode tab 3, negative electrode tab 4, closing plate 5, rubber buffer 6, positioning bolt 7, protective housing 8, guard plate 9, the airtight protective aluminum film 1 that has been packaged in the winding of 2 outside of electric core, 2 one side tops of electric core are provided with positive electrode tab 3 and negative electrode tab 4, 2 suits of electric core are installed at 8 internal diameters of protective housing and use closing plate 5 and 6 location of rubber buffer to fix a position, positioning bolt 7 presss from both sides tight location with electric core 2 and protective housing 8, the 8 outside of protective housing is provided with guard plate 9 and does the impact protection.
8 plate bodies of protective housing are by subbase 10, location thread section of thick bamboo 11 and triangle-shaped buffer board 12 are constituteed, it has triangle-shaped buffer board 12 to lay based on subbase 10 plate body equipartition, triangle-shaped buffer board 12 is that multiunit triangle-shaped plate body is constituteed, high structural strength, impact resistance is good, can effectual buffering external impact, reduce the injury of strikeing to electric core 2, location thread section of thick bamboo 11 position corresponds the setting with positioning bolt 7 positions, external force strikes that it strikes angle of triangle-shaped buffer board 12 can take place certain deflection, the frontal impact has been avoided.
Positioning bolt 7 comprises cross screwhead 13, screw rod 14 and supporting rubber pad 15, and cross screwhead 13 and the design of 14 integral types of screw rod, 14 screw rods are the initiative and are passed its body of rod and tightly withhold supporting rubber pad 15 behind the location screw thread section of thick bamboo 11, and supporting rubber pad 15 and 2 hard contacts of electric core, and supporting rubber pad 15 is the structural support of 2 rigidity of electric core, avoids electric core to take place to slide at protective housing 8 internal diameter, has guaranteed the accuracy of installation station.
The protection plate 9 is made of an aluminum alloy honeycomb plate, and is light in weight, high in structural strength and good in puncture resistance.
The utility model discloses the theory of operation: the utility model provides a lithium ion battery cell module, protective housing has the triangle-shaped buffer board based on bottom substrate plate body equipartition is mated formation, and the triangle-shaped buffer board comprises multiunit triangle-shaped plate body, and structural strength is high, and impact resistance is good, can effectual buffering external impact, reduces the injury of assaulting to electric core, and the structural support of electric core rigidity is done to the supporting rubber pad, avoids electric core to take place to slide at the protective housing internal diameter, and the guard plate is the aluminum alloy honeycomb panel material, and matter light structural strength is high.
